Описание тега gnuplot
Gnuplot - это портативная графическая утилита, управляемая из командной строки, для Linux, OS/2, MS Windows, OSX, VMS и многих других платформ. Используйте этот тег для вопросов о программном использовании Gnuplot; отладка интерактивного использования не по теме.
3
ответа
Как установить переменную ширину линии при построении?
Я хотел бы построить кривую с переменной шириной линии. Я обычно делал бы следующее, если бы я хотел использовать точки вместо линии: gnuplot> plot 'curve.dat' u ($1):($2):($1) ps var где curve.dat заполнен: 0 0 1 1 2 4 3 9 4 16 5 25 и так далее.…
10 сен '18 в 01:59
1
ответ
gnuplot, разбить ось Y на две части
У меня есть гистограмма с небольшими значениями и очень большими значениями. Как я могу разбить ось Y на две части? РЕДАКТИРОВАТЬ: Пример gnuplot: set style histogram columnstacked set style data histograms set key autotitle columnheader plot for [i…
10 июл '13 в 07:12
0
ответов
Как передать Ruby-Gnuplot/Multiplot в файл?
Пример require 'gnuplot' require 'gnuplot/multiplot' def sample x = (0..50).collect { |v| v.to_f } mult2 = x.map {|v| v * 2 } squares = x.map {|v| v * 4 } Gnuplot.open do |gp| Gnuplot::Multiplot.new(gp, layout: [2,1]) do |mp| Gnuplot::Plot.new(mp) {…
28 сен '17 в 14:15
1
ответ
gnuplot - как я могу использовать первое значение столбца im plotting?
У меня есть файл данных, который выглядит так: #processors timea timeb 1 45 150 2 25 80 3 13.43 60.2 4 10 40 5 8 38 6 7 35 7 6.5 34.2 8 5 32 Мне нужно построить соответствующие кривые ускорения, что в основном plot 'datapoints.dat' u $1:((first_valc…
03 июл '13 в 21:28
2
ответа
Gnuplot: построение графиков различий между двумя матрицами
У меня есть два файла file1.dat а также file2.dat что каждый из них содержит матрицу (скажем, F1 и F2 соответственно), которые согласуются по размерам (т.е. они оба m x n матрицы). Я знаю, как использовать gnuplot для построения любого из них (splot…
10 апр '12 в 15:00
1
ответ
gnuplot: построение одной точки из переменной
Я хотел бы напечатать несколько отдельных точек на графике. Значения для этих точек используются ранее в том же словаре. Каждый из напечатанных пунктов должен быть отмечен на легенде. До сих пор самым близким был этот plot '-' w p ls 1, '-' w p ls 2…
05 июл '15 в 08:47
0
ответов
gnuplot в windows требует закрытия и повторного открытия для повторной загрузки после ошибки "Вы не можете изменить терминал..."
У меня проблема с "Вы не можете изменить терминал в режиме мультиплота", хотя инструкции из stackru были выполнены; например, по этой ссылке. Ошибка появляется снова и снова, если я не закрою gnuplot и не открою его снова (изменение каталога в окнах…
28 июн '17 в 08:30
1
ответ
Как добавить указанный цвет к 2-й кривой на 3-м графике в Gnuplot?
У меня был рабочий код следующим образом: set term postscript eps enhanced color set output "C:\\Users\\cole1\\Desktop\\gnuplot_w1.eps" set multiplot set isosamples 140 unset key set title "r" set xrange [-6:6] set yrange [-6:6] set zrange [-4:4] se…
22 дек '13 в 23:53
1
ответ
Построение графика на последнем графике с использованием gnuplot-iostream
Я использую gnuplot-iostream для построения точек данных. Итак, у меня есть два комплекта. Я могу успешно построить первый набор, но он терпит неудачу во втором наборе. first_pts = {....}; second_pts = {....}; Gnuplot gp2d; gp2d << "set xrange…
04 июн '18 в 22:44
2
ответа
Ограничение диапазона на логарифмическом графике в gnuplot
Я пытаюсь подогнать сюжет в gnuplot, используя logscale. У меня 50000 точек данных. Сначала я подхожу к сюжету таким образом. f(x) = b + m*x fit f(x) "xyMSD-all-mal-cel-iso-bcm-thermo2.dat" using 1:2 via m,b Я получил значение наклона. Затем я попыт…
08 апр '13 в 12:18
2
ответа
Объединить гистограммы в gnuplot (средневзвешенное число бинов)
Допустим, у меня есть две части данных для одного и того же количества, каждая из которых имеет свою ошибку. В частности, у меня есть две гистограммы в файлах gnuplot примерно в форматеxA yA dyA для гистограммы АxB yB dyB для гистограммы B (значения…
03 май '15 в 14:02
1
ответ
Тепловая карта GNUPlot из матрицы текстового файла
У меня есть большая матрица (4900 x 64), хранящаяся в текстовом файле, которую я хотел бы построить в виде тепловой карты. Выходное изображение должно быть уровнем дБ каждого матричного элемента, сопоставленным с любой цветовой шкалой. Преобразовани…
14 окт '14 в 09:41
1
ответ
Порог z-диапазона для матричной тепловой карты в Gnuplot
Справочная информация: у меня есть матрица взаимной корреляции строк i и столбцов j, в которой значения только z находятся в диапазоне от -1 до 1. Я могу вывести хорошую тепловую карту, используя следующий скрипт: unset key set tic scale 1 set xtics…
19 мар '14 в 11:32
1
ответ
Как передать переменную, определенную в C, в Gnuplot через канал?
Мне нужно передать переменную, определенную в моей основной программе (обычный C), в Gnuplot через канал. Как я могу это сделать? Любая помощь очень ценится. Спасибо PS: Ubuntu 12.04.3 LTS, GCC 4.6.3 Код: FILE *pipe = popen("gnuplot -persist","w"); …
22 дек '13 в 22:56
0
ответов
Gnuplot: вывод данных из нескольких подкаталогов на одном графике
Предположим, у меня есть каталог результатов со многими подкаталогами, по одному для каждого эксперимента. В каждом из этих подкаталогов находятся файлы данных, поэтому все выглядит так: results exp_1 data_file.dat other non-relevant stuff exp_2 dat…
09 янв '16 в 09:26
1
ответ
Как построить данные во время их обработки
Я нахожусь в процессе преобразования большого (несколько ГБ) бинарного файла в формат csv с использованием Python, чтобы можно было построить полученные данные. Я делаю это преобразование, потому что файл bin находится не в формате, понятном инструм…
15 июн '16 в 15:08
3
ответа
Риски безопасности веб-интерфейса gnuplot
Мне нужно сделать своего рода веб-интерфейс gnuplot, который получает список команд или файл, сохраняет его на диск и говорит gnuplot преобразовать его в png ("установить терминал png; установить вывод..."). Какие неприятные или глупые вещи может де…
07 июн '12 в 18:22
1
ответ
Обработка неоднородных тиков в gnuplot
Я строю свой график с помощью gnuplot. У меня проблема в том, что мои точки данных на оси х не равны. Таким образом, форма графика оказывается грязной. Как вы можете видеть на графике, число по оси x составляет 32,64,128,256,512. Я хочу иметь равное…
24 фев '16 в 19:49
1
ответ
Могу ли я получить доступ к отсортированному выводу команды Gnuplot "stats"?
Согласно статистике Gnuplot, ... Значения данных сортируются, чтобы найти медианные и квартильные границы.... Мне интересно, могу ли я получить доступ к этим отсортированным данным? Например, могу ли я получить доступ к 10-му наименьшему значению, а…
21 июл '14 в 17:27
1
ответ
Рассчитать среднее значение между столбцами нескольких файлов в gnuplot для linux
У меня есть список каталогов (например, 0, 50, 100, 150, 200 и т. Д.), Каждый из которых содержит файл с именем zb_p.xy с двумя столбцами данных. Вот примеры таких файлов: # file 0/zb_p.xy 1 0.1 2 0.2 3 0.15 4 0.11 # file 50/zb_p.xy 1 0.0 2 0.4 3 0.…
25 ноя '15 в 12:27